I'm having some really nasty problems trying to get a Linksys WPC11 (v3) 
pcmcia card to work with wlan-ng-0.2 & 2.4.21.  Whenever pcmcia starts, 
i get a high pitched, and then a low pitched beep, and I see the 
following errors:
prsm2_cs: RequestIRQ: Resource in use
prsm2sta_config: NextTuple failure? Its probably a Vcc mismatch.
prsm2sta_event: prsm2_cs: Initialization failed!

WHat is most frustrating is that everything works just fine when booting 
into the RH9 default kernel.  Its just my newly built 2.4.21 that is 
causing the problems.  So i'm wondering if i'm possibly not building the 
kernel right, since i've never used wlan-ng until now?
